The Joint Presidential Transition Team will meet today, Wednesday, December 11, 2024, as part of the transition process.

President Akufo-Addo had announced the date in a statement that released the list of the government’s team.

“We agreed on an early inauguration of a joint transitional team as early as Wednesday the 11th of December,” President-elect John Dramani Mahama announced in his victory speech shortly after being declared the winner of the Presidential Election with 56.55% of the valid votes cast.

Mr. Mahama said he had received a congratulatory call from President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o.

The two leaders discussed matters related to the joint transitional team.

“I conveyed my sincerest regards to him and expressed my readiness for us to work together to ensure a smooth transition in the best interest of the Ghanaian people,” the president-elect stated.

The following persons constitute the Government side of the Transition Team:

Head of the Presidential Staff appointed under the Presidential Office Act, 1993 (Act 463) [Chief of
Staff] – Hon. Akosua Frema Osei-Opare
The Attorney-General – Godfred Yeboah Dame
Minister responsible for Presidential Affairs – Hon. Osei Kyei-Mensah-Bonsu
Minister responsible for Finance – Hon. Dr. Mohammed Amin Adam
Minister responsible for the Interior – Hon. Henry Quartey
Minister responsible for Defence – Hon. Dominic Nitiwul
Minister responsible for Foreign Affairs – Hon. Shirley Ayorkor Botchwey
Minister responsible for Local Government – Hon. Martin Adjei-Mensah Korsah
Minister responsible for National Security – Hon. Albert Kan Dapaah
The Head of Civil Service – Dr. Evans Aggrey-Darkoh
The Head of the Local Government Service – Dr. Nana Ato Arthur
The Secretary to the Cabinet – Ambassador Mercy Debrah-Karikari
The National Security Coordinator – Mr. Edward Asomani”
The incoming government side has the following;

1.Hon. Julius Debrah – Co-Chairperson
2. Hon. Johnson Asiedu Nketia – Member
3. Hon. Fifi Fiavi Kwetey – Member
4. Dr. Callistus Mahama– Member/Secretary to the Transition Team
5. Dr. Valerie Sawyer – Member
6. Prof. Kwamena Ahwoi – Member
7. Hon. Dr. Cassiel Ato Forson – Member
8. Hon. Mahama Ayariga – Member
9. Hon. Goosie Tanoh – Member
10. Dr. Edward Omane Boamah – Member
